Transaction dd4f648f70233205fb96031c9832e1bb3194cc0ab15f951dea5d60ffafb1861e

200 Input
1 Outputs
  • dd4f648f70233205fb96031c9832e1bb3194cc0ab15f951dea5d60ffafb1861e:0
  • value  1225258849
    address  1KFLByCxPSk2kAW175qbUfisNN5fqr3R3m